PROFILE:
The Fire Alarm InspectionTechnician is responsible for testing fire, security, and sprinkler systems in the Baltimore region.
Duties/Responsibilities:
Test electronic alarm systems consisting of fire, security, access, sprinkler, etc. (i.e., test flow switches, tamper valves, low temp devices, smoke detectors, duct detectors, pull stations, fire doors, heat detectors, annunciators, hi-low air switches, communicators, fire and security alarm control panels, etc.).
Generates electronic and paper documentation for the purpose of system certification in a timely, efficient manner. This includes preparing work orders, deficiency reports, check-lists, and certification reports.
Operating/maintaining company vehicle.
Communicates with ARK team members to effectively pursue company goals of certifying alarm systems according to acceptable standards and practices.
Presents themselves in a positive, professional manner and per company policy.
Communicates with customer concerning the importance, operation and status of their fire alarm system.
Supervises Assistant Tester to ensure proper certification of the sprinkler systems.
Performs minor repairs of the above referenced equipment.
